NASHVILLE, Tenn. (WTVF) — President Donald Trump has granted clemency to a Clarksville man who was serving a mandatory life sentence for drug-related charges.
Trump commuted the sentence for Chris Young as part of his last-minute pardons and commutations before leaving office.
Former federal judge Kevin Sharp, who sentenced Young to life in prison, later became one of his biggest allies, saying the life sentence was cruel and unjust. At the time, Sharp s hands were tied because the sentence was mandatory. ....

President Donald Trump handed out nearly 100 commutations and pardons in one of his last acts as the head of state. Several high-profile pardons predictably went to his staunch supporters, but some of the others may surprise you.
Steve Bannon was pardoned for his role in defrauding hundreds of thousands of donors as part of a scheme to raise money for Trump’s border wall. Rapper Lil’ Wayne, whose real name is Dwayne Michael Carter Jr., was pardoned for a 10-year-old federal firearms conviction. ....
